This is the original 340 to my '73.  Button Automotive Machine Shop Service, Inc. in O'Fallon, Missouri did the machine work and assembled most of the shortblock to ensure that 4-bolt mains and stroker crank fit and rotated correctly.

The block was bored .030" over with torque plates and
square decked by .010".  The Milodon 4-bolt main caps were line bored and line honed after the machine work was complete for their installation.  Notches were made in the block for rod swing clearance due to the Mopar Performance 4.0" stroker crank and the Eagle H-beam rods.  400 grit stones were used in the cylinders for file fitted moly rings.  New cam bearings, freeze plugs, distributor bushing and oil galley plugs were installed and the whole rotating assembly was balanced.

Ross 8:1 blower pistons, Edelbrock aluminum heads, Crane 1.5 roller rockers and a mild Crane Powermax cam will be part of this combination, as well as a Stage 1, Small Diameter
BDS 6-71 blower and two BDS prepped Holley 600's.

The plan for my little 340... 5.6% overdriven (Crank Pulley = 36 Teeth / Top Pulley = 34 Teeth), 5.5-6.0#'s of boost and a final compression ratio of 11.1:1.

Me and a buddy were tasked with indexing the BDS crank hub.  We found true TDC and scribed a mark on the crank hub and added the timing tape supplied by BDS.
